I opened the file subj/surf/?h.thickness with MATLAB using the function read_curv(subj/surf/lh.thickness). I obtained a vector with dimensions nverticesX1, but I need also the vertex IDs. Are vertex IDs in the thickness file ordered from 0 to n? Is there some other way to obtain a table with vertex IDs and the corresponding thickness values?

@avram:as you suggested, I tryed to use MRIread('subj/surf/lh.thickness.mgh'), it doesn't return the  desired values. You can find the result in the attachment .
